Guillermo Díaz-Fañas is a Dominican national and civil engineer with international experience who specializes in recovery and disaster planning. In 2018, he was honored as a New Face of Civil Engineering by the ASCE. He also founded the Queer Advocacy Knowledge Exchange (Qu-AKE) that serves as a network to support LGBTQ+ professionals with visibility and community.
Simon Crowther, based in the UK, is an award-winning civil engineer & flooding specialist recognized by Forbes’ 2018 “30 under 30” list. He founded his own company while still a student in university and his work focuses on raising awareness of and reducing flood risk.
Maria Carlota Costallat de Macedo Soares is a Brazilian, self-taught landscape architect known for her design and urban planning of the Flamengo Park in Rio de Janeiro. The park consists of a large botanical garden, a museum, and recreational spaces for visitors. It is one of the largest urban parks in Brazil spanning 296 acres, it is believed to be inspired by Central Park in New York.
